Frequently Asked Questions

Why choose Sri Lanka for a wellness retreat?

Sri Lanka is home to exceptional retreats such as Sen Wellness Sanctuary on the south coast and Santani Wellness Resort in the hills near Kandy. These retreats specialise in Ayurveda, yoga, detox and holistic healing, all set in tranquil natural surroundings.

What types of wellness programmes are available in Sri Lanka?

Wellness retreats in Sri Lanka offer a variety of programmes including traditional Ayurveda retreats, yoga, meditation, stress relief, detox and Panchakarma. Many also include daily treatments, wellness consultations and mindfulness practices rooted in ancient wisdom.

When is the best time to visit a wellness retreat in Sri Lanka?

The best time to visit is between December and April on the south and west coasts, and May to September for the east coast. The central hills remain pleasant year-round.
